Account previously posted for the custodian file date.

This soft warning indicates that, for the date range being imported, transactions for the account in question have already been imported and posted to your practice. The warning can be handled by taking one of the following action:

To determine if the imported transactions are duplicates, do the following:

  1. Return to the main Morningstar Office window. (You can leave the Import and Blotter windows open.)

  2. Go to the Portfolio Management tab, and select the Accounts page.

  3. Double-click the account in question to open it.

  4. From the Account window, select the Transactions page.

  1. Check to see if the transaction(s) in the blotter have indeed already been posted to the account. If not, you can safely post the data.

  2. If the transaction(s) have already been posted to the account, return to the Blotter window and navigate to the Transactions blotter.

  3. Select the transaction(s).

  4. From the toolbar above the spreadsheet view, click the Action menu.

  5. From the Action menu, select Delete.

  1. A confirmation message appears. Click Yes to delete the account.

  2. When the confirmation message appears, click OK.
